ZAF to use $300,000 grant to increase production of nickel-zinc batteries
Nickel-zinc (NiZn) specialist ZAF Energy Systems has received $300,000, the first installment of a $600,000 investment from Missouri’s Department of Economic Development. With the new funding, ZAF will increase production capacity to meet the increasing demand for its NiZn batteries. Sila Nano raises $70 million in funding for silicon-dominant battery anodes
Battery specialist Sila Nanotechnologies has received $70 million in Series D funding from Sutter Hill Ventures, Next47 (backed by Siemens), and Amperex. Sila Nano will use the funding for the development and commercialization of its silicon-dominant anodes. Dana to design drivetrain for Mecalac’s electric excavator
Auto tech specialist Dana has been working to create a drivetrain for the Mecalac e12 electric compact wheeled excavator. The vehicle will use Mecalac’s 12MTX as a base frame, Spicer 112 axles and a Spicer 367 shift-on-fly transmission. Hyundai invests in solid-state battery materials specialist Ionic Materials
Hyundai’s venture capital division, Cradle, is investing in Massachusetts-based battery materials developer Ionic Materials. Ionic says its patented solid polymer material enables solid-state batteries that are inherently safe, high in energy density and operational at room temperature.
